Output e6ef17bd5fd47bc521541392cc2bd1e65d4ea30e87a1de636a978e8eccffaecd:4

value
513300
script pubkey
OP_0 OP_PUSHBYTES_20 aee6820c8700d1965120edae80b645fcfba47f9b
address
bc1q4mngyry8qrgev5fqakhgpdj9lna6glum68mwps
transaction
e6ef17bd5fd47bc521541392cc2bd1e65d4ea30e87a1de636a978e8eccffaecd
confirmations
78036
spent
true